Obviously, I'm doing an all nighter here. As I didn't notice that quickzero is doing it's movem 8 times, 4*8*8 = 256. But, for some reason this precise routine bzero is writing beyond it's boundaries in the arp_alloc routine. Commenting out bzero, it works perfectly.
Attachment:
pgpeny4Edy_l3.pgp
Description: signature